The game of blackjack is known to be the most popular card game at casinos everywhere. This is most probably because blackjack rules are easy enough to learn and straightforward enough to understand, making it a game that anyone can play. Also known as 21 and pontoon, blackjack is one of the card games that actually gives a player an edge over the house. Blackjack is a counting game, with mathematical strategies involved. This is also one of the reasons for its immense popularity: the use of skill plus luck in winning a game.

The basic objective of blackjack is for the cards you hold, or your “hand” to reach 21. Anything over 21 is a bust, and the player with the highest total of cards below 21 wins. Blackjack can be played using any number of decks from 1 to 8, and the ultimate goal is to beat the dealer with a winning hand.

The cards' values are those printed on them, regardless of the suit, except for the face cards: jack, queen and king. These cards are equivalent to ten. The ace is a special case. It can either be a one or an eleven depending on your hand.
